Berlin is a city that reveals a different character with every season. From long summer evenings to quieter winter days, life in the German capital follows a rhythm that shapes how residents experience their surroundings.
Spring brings renewed energy to the city. Parks, canals, and green spaces begin to fill with life, offering places to walk, cycle, or simply pause. Near Neukölln and Britz, destinations such as Tempelhofer Feld and Britzer Garten become everyday retreats for residents living in nearby rental apartments in Berlin.
Summer is defined by outdoor culture. Tempelhofer Feld turns into a vast playground for movement, picnics, and evening walks, while green residential neighborhoods offer shaded streets and quieter moments. Well-located apartments for rent in Berlin make it easy to enjoy both vibrant city life and natural open spaces.
Autumn introduces a slower pace. As temperatures drop, the city’s parks transform into calmer, more reflective spaces. Walks through Britzer Garten or nearby green areas become part of daily routines, while cultural life shifts indoors.
